Ever finished a calculation and immediately forgot how you got there? A regular calculator discards the steps the moment you hit equals. Even if you paste the result into a notes app, days later you’re staring at a number with no context. CalcNote solves that exact problem.

I built CalcNote because I kept re-doing the same math. Whether splitting a dinner bill, calculating freelance quotes, converting currencies while traveling, or tracking household expenses, I’d reach a number and then think: wait, how did I get that? Copying just the answer into my notes app didn’t help—a week later the logic was gone. I wanted a tool that saved the whole expression, not just the result, so I could trace my reasoning anytime.
How It Works
- Save the full expression with the result. Every time you tap equals, your entire calculation—like “38000 ÷ 4 = 9500″—stacks up as a card. The reasoning stays visible, not buried under a pile of forgotten numbers.
- Organize calculations into colored folders. Create folders for Budget, Renovation Quote, Currency Conversion, or Group Split. Assign each folder a color so you can spot the right one at a glance. Filing is optional, so even a quick save keeps things tidy.
- Precise math you can trust. All calculations use exact arithmetic with no floating-point errors. You control the rounding precision yourself, so quotes, bill splits, and bookkeeping stay accurate.
- Search through hundreds of saved calculations instantly. Look up any calculation by expression, folder label, or result number. You’ll never lose “that one calculation” again.
- Export and import your entire history. Back up all your calculations to a single file or restore them when you switch phones. Your data stays on your device by default—no account signup required.

The app respects your privacy. Your calculation records live only on your device unless you explicitly export them. There’s no login, no cloud sync, and no account to create. CalcNote is free and ad-supported; a single in-app purchase removes ads permanently.
